Michael Watson visits Meridian to announce bid for lieutenant governor
Mississippi Secretary of State Michael Watson held an event at Jean’s Restaurant in Meridian Wednesday announcing he will seek the office of lieutenant governor in 2027, pointing to his record in the state Senate and as the state’s top elections official as the foundation for his campaign.
Speaking to those attending, Watson said his decision followed years of public service and reflection on how he could “do more good for Mississippi.”
Watson, a Pascagoula native, described his upbringing as the son of a shipfitter and a teacher, saying those early experiences shaped his approach to public service.
“We didn’t have a whole lot of money, and so we had to make tough decisions,” he said. “The key is to use the power for the people, making sure the people are taken care of.” (Continue Reading)
